Résumé

Infrastructures to provide access to custom integrated hardware manufacturing facilities are important because they allow Students and Researchers to access professional facilities at a reasonable cost, and they allow Companies to access small volume production, otherwise difficult to obtain directly from manufacturers. This paper is reviewing the developments at CMP to offer various types of MEMS manufacturing to Students, Researchers and Companies since 1994. CMP has been the first service of its type to introduce MEMS fabrication. Today CMP is offering bulk micromachining on CMOS and GaAs, and various MEMS processes. CAD tools provided by CMP are also reviewed.
